ABOUT SEEDHI BAAT

What Is Seedhi Baat?

Seedhi Baat (सीधी बात) is India's civic feedback platform— a free Progressive Web App that lets any Indian citizen report civic issues directly to their Lok Sabha Member of Parliament (MP) in under 8 seconds. "Seedhi Baat" means "straight talk" in Hindi, which is exactly what the platform does: it puts your voice on your elected representative's record, without bureaucratic filters.

How does Seedhi Baat work?

Citizens join the waitlist, receive a constituency-linked account, and then file structured civic feedback — selecting a category (Roads & Potholes, Water Supply, Electricity, Garbage, Street Lighting, etc.), sub-issue, severity, and duration. Feedback is logged against the reporter's Lok Sabha constituency. In Phase 2, MPs and their constituency offices receive weekly reports aggregating all feedback from their area. The public leaderboard ranks all 543 Lok Sabha constituencies by growth score — so every citizen can see whether their constituency is engaged or apathetic.

Is my identity protected?

Anonymous by default. Your phone number is never shown publicly. Your feedback appears in aggregate reports — 47 residents of Pune North reported Road & Pothole issues this week — without revealing any individual identity. You can choose to make your name public if you wish, but anonymity is the default setting. This design choice reflects the reality of civic life in India, where power asymmetries between residents and local officials make anonymous feedback significantly safer and more honest than named complaints.

What is the difference between an MP and an MLA?

An MP (Member of Parliament) is elected to the Lok Sabha (lower house of Parliament) and represents a Lok Sabha constituency, of which there are 543 across India. An MLA (Member of the Legislative Assembly) represents a state assembly constituency and sits in the state Vidhan Sabha. Seedhi Baat focuses on Lok Sabha MPs because Parliament is where national policy — roads, railways, national highways, central government schemes, MPLADS fund allocation — is decided. State-level issues are tracked separately and routed to the relevant state constituency data.
